Output 5857eb132949d26b14cb3e62c8dfe4aa68e6bc0db2a62dccd8dcd20b6df5cbdb:1

value
78817395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 689b4920d7f368055148cde5156486e8f7f3b05b OP_EQUAL
address
MHSGXpMFC6Ch3UYfhC32GXshq7FdnwEmjy
transaction
5857eb132949d26b14cb3e62c8dfe4aa68e6bc0db2a62dccd8dcd20b6df5cbdb
spent
true